Create a website to display UFO sighting data that can be filtered by various fields like: Date, City, State, Country, Shape, Comment. The data is displayed in a table form dynamically based on the user input given. This is achieved using Event handlers in Javascript.
I created a basic HTML web page that on loading, populates the table with all UFO sightings. This table is filtered dynamically based on the criteria that user selects. I created a Javascript that listens for events when a search criteria is selected and appends the data that matches to the table dynamically. The website created looks like this -
I deployed the website using Heroku and FLASK. The deployed app is - https://pg-ufo.herokuapp.com/